What This Guide Helps With
This guide addresses situations where the Stryker InTouch bed fails to detect brake pedal engagement. Symptoms may include:
- Bed does not register when brakes are applied
- Alarms or warnings related to bed mobility
- Inability to safely lock/unlock bed wheels
The focus is on simple external checks and verifying user setup before considering internal component failure.
Step-by-Step Troubleshooting
Verify Bed Power
- Ensure the bed is powered on and the battery is charged.
- Many sensors rely on active power to communicate; without power, the brake pedal signal may not register.
Inspect Brake Pedal Mechanically
- Press each brake pedal and observe for smooth movement.
- Ensure nothing is physically blocking or jamming the pedal (linen, wheels misalignment, debris).
Check Brake Pedal Sensor Connection
- Locate the sensor near the brake assembly.
- Verify the sensor harness is securely connected, not loose, pinched, or damaged.
Test Brake Functionality Indicator
- Many InTouch beds have indicator lights on the control panel when brakes are engaged.
- Apply brakes and watch the indicator; if no response, suspect sensor or connection.
Swap Pedal Sides (If Possible)
- If the bed has dual pedals and one side works, compare wiring and sensor functionality.
- This can help isolate whether the issue is the pedal, sensor, or wiring.
Check for Error Codes on Bed Display
- Observe the InTouch display for any specific brake or sensor fault codes.
- Note codes for work order documentation.
If the Problem Persists
External checks suggest power, mechanical movement, and wiring are intact. The brake pedal sensor itself is likely defective.
- Remove bed from service
- Label as Out of Service
- Send for manufacturer repair or bench evaluation
Knowing when to stop is proper troubleshooting; do not attempt internal sensor repair yourself.
Clinical Use Tip
Do not rely on a bed with a non-functioning brake while a patient is on it. Move the patient to a different bed or ensure brakes are verified before patient transfer. Always troubleshoot when the bed is unoccupied for safety.
Work Order Documentation (CCR Method)
CCR = Complaint, Cause, Resolution
Complaint
What was reported by the clinical staff.
Example:
“Bed does not register brake engagement; alarms indicate brake fault.”
Cause
What was observed during troubleshooting.
Example:
“Brake pedal sensor unresponsive; mechanical pedal and wiring inspected and appear intact.”
Resolution
What action was taken.
Example:
“Bed removed from service, labeled Out of Service, sent for bench evaluation/repair.”
Helpful Details to Include
- Bed battery status verified
- Pedal movement smooth and unobstructed
- Sensor harness inspected and secured
- Any error codes observed on the display
